Property highlight: Substantial detached four bedroom farmhouse with 178 sqm of living space
Sharplaw Farmhouse is set in an elevated position with stunning uninterrupted views overlooking the rolling borders countryside. The property is situated in a semi-rural location with easy access available to the vibrant town of Jedburgh and nearby countryside trails. The dwelling itself would benefit from cosmetic upgrading and would allow scope for the purchaser to sympathetically renovate this late 19th century farmhouse to their own unique taste. The ground floor of the property comprises of the kitchen/diner, sitting room, drawing room, utility and WC. Moving upstairs, the property is home to the master bedroom with en-suite bathroom, two further generous double bedrooms, and the fourth bedroom which could be equally well utilised as a home office for those who require working from home capability, and the family bathroom. Sharplaw Farmhouse retains many attractive features including the two multi fuel stoves, high ceilings, deep skirtings & working shutters - also of particular note are the photovoltaic solar panels, contributing towards improved energy efficiency. Externally, there is a driveway pertaining to the property, in addition to the well manicured garden grounds to the front, side and rear, bordered by a dry stone wall and beech hedging for privacy. Also of particular note, are the two stone built outbuildings which provide additional external storage/workshop space away from the main dwelling.
